The Smith Area Division of the NAACP commemorated progression and also the success of their scholarship receivers, whereas identifying that newest events have actually verified there might be job however to do.
More than 250 people went to the yearly Flexibility Fund Scholarship Reception on Thursday at Harvey Seminar Center. This one year’s recipient was Elizabeth R. Ford.
University of Texas at Tyler Head of state Michael Tidwell in addition recognized amongst the indigenous receivers of the professors’s brand-new complete scholarship Presidential Fellows Scholarship that went to.
The evening’s various guest of honors consisted of Black Registered nurses Shake Tyler, Gamma Omicron Omega Phase of the Alpha Kappa Alpha Sorority and also the Tyler Alumnae Phase of Delta Sigma Theta Sorority.
Tyler Mayor Martin Heines discover an announcement in honor of the team and also the celebration. He prompted everyone to recognize the accomplishments and also payments of the Tyler-Smith Area Division of the NAACP.
Smith Area Commissioner JoAnn Hampton talked briefly at the beginning of the celebration. She really did not right deal with Commissioner Jeff Warr’s Tuesday assertion that he could not aid a choice announcing Thursday as “NAACP Tyler-Smith Area Day.”
Warr specified he took scenario with the across the country team’s aid for activities he’s adamantly versus, evocative “the objection of our across the country anthem by some NFL players and also makes an effort to differ historic past to adapt to presently’s political accuracy.”
Warr later on encouraged the Tyler Early morning Telegraph that he discovers it difficult to divide the program of the across the country team from the indigenous phase.
“Regardless of what others claim, what others would potentially actually feel, I’m honored to encounter right below and also interact to you,” Hampton encouraged participants.
Site visitor audio speaker the Rev. Darryl Bowdre talked in relation to the one year’s style “We Rise” and also the well worth in determination when it looks like progression is being lost.

He dealt with each the option of the Commissioners Court docket and also Tyler ISD’s future ballot over the title of Robert E. Lee Excessive Professors. The Tyler ISD board has not however established a day for the ballot.
“After they requested me to speak technique once more in January, I didn’t understand what I utilized to be mosting likely to review, nonetheless as God would certainly have it, the fantastic city of Tyler has actually offered me my product,” the previous Tyler City Council participant specified.
Bowdre initially dealt with the activities of the Commissioners Court docket, and also the contrary participants’ rejection to 2nd Hampton’s motion to recognize the team.
“I intend to interact on what the Smith Area commissioners did. At first, for them to attack this team, be it regionally or across the country, and also for them to use the reason they have actually remained in resistance to the (Colin Kaepernick) stooping, I’ve gotten to call them out as an outcome of they’re incorrect,” Bowdre specified.
“Allow’s encounter the information, Kaepernick began to stoop to draw in factor to consider to black men being eliminated by guideline enforcement. Currently, Trump is gonna exchange it and also claim it’s rude to our navy. Don’t say with us regarding our patriots. Black individuals have actually passed away (in each U.S. fight). It’s about black men being eliminated by cops and also the cops leaving.”
Bowdre after that dealt with the future ballot to relabel Robert E. Lee Excessive Professors.
“To be able to be a rose, you’ve gotten to establish the thorns, and also we’ve gotten some thorns on this city. We’ve gotten some thorns on our rose and also I’m not mosting likely to act choose it does not damages,” he specified. “Why do people decline to comprehend what the title Robert E. Lee does to us?”
Bowdre disregarded insurance claims that the identifying of and also battle to keep Robert E. Lee as a symbol was not regarding race. He specified it was eye-catching that individuals hold stating to navigate on from the inconvenience to relabel the university, whereas hanging on to their love of the Confederacy.
“It never should certainly have actually been called that within the starting point. It never ought to have, and also you might’t view why it affects us choose it does?” he proceeded.
Bowdre specified that to make sure that progression to be made, people of all races intend to encounter jointly to do what is right.
“There’s some disturbance onward, and also I do understand it’s been simply a little rough, however it undoubtedly’s mosting likely to keep being … given that you’ve gotten to be eager to encounter flat-footed and also make the ideal resolution,” he specified. “Everyone should stand. Individuals of all colours, we need to stand jointly. We need to comprehend we currently have a similar battle.”
Bowdre specified his hope is that participants of the Tyler ISD board ultimately will signify the wish of their components.
